Some Jamaican folk tales are taken more seriously than others. Some supernatural creatures, such as Duppies and Rolling Calves are widely believed in, or at a minimum, speculated about by many. Other aspects of folklore such as Anansi stories and Big Boy stories, are taken as pure fiction, and are told just for fun. In a nutshell, the four great folktales of China are Liang Shanbo and Zhu Yingtai, Tale of the White Snake, Lady Meng Jiang, and The Cowherd and the Weaving Girl (Niu Lang and Zhi Nu). Cinderella.
